
This taco salad is a delicious and simple way to enjoy all the flavors of tacos in a fresh, crunchy bowl!
Ingredients:
For the Salad:
• 1 lb ground beef
• 1 tablespoon olive oil
• 1 teaspoon salt
• 1 teaspoon black pepper
• 1 teaspoon chili powder
• 1 teaspoon cumin
• 1/2 teaspoon garlic powder
• 1/2 teaspoon onion powder
• 1/4 teaspoon paprika
• 1/4 teaspoon crushed red pepper (optional)
• 1/2 cup water
Salad Base:
• 1 head romaine lettuce, chopped
• 1 cup cherry tomatoes, halved
• 1/2 cup shredded cheddar or Monterey Jack cheese
• 1/2 cup black beans, drained and rinsed
• 1/2 cup corn (fresh, frozen, or canned)
• 1/4 cup diced red onion
• 1/4 cup sliced black olives (optional)
• 1/2 cup crushed tortilla chips
For the Dressing:
• 1/2 cup sour cream or Greek yogurt
• 1/4 cup salsa
• 1 tablespoon lime juice
• 1/2 teaspoon cumin
• 1/2 teaspoon garlic powder
• Salt and pepper to taste
Instructions:
Prepare the Ground Beef:
1. Heat olive oil in a skillet over medium heat.
2. Add ground beef and cook until browned, breaking it up with a spatula (about 5–7 minutes).
3. Drain excess fat, then stir in salt, pepper, chili powder, cumin, garlic powder, onion powder, paprika, and crushed red pepper.
4. Add 1/2 cup water and let simmer for 5 minutes until the liquid is mostly absorbed. Remove from heat and set aside.
Make the Dressing:
1. In a small bowl, mix sour cream (or Greek yogurt), salsa, lime juice, cumin, garlic powder, salt, and pepper. Stir until well combined.
Assemble the Salad:
1. In a large bowl, combine chopped romaine lettuce, cherry tomatoes, shredded cheese, black beans, corn, red onion, and black olives.
2. Add the cooked ground beef on top.
3. Drizzle the dressing over the salad and toss lightly to combine.
4. Sprinkle with crushed tortilla chips for crunch.
Serve immediately and enjoy your fresh, flavorful taco salad!
